轻质固化粉煤灰回填软土地基路堤工后沉降分析

摘    要:回填轻质固化粉煤灰可以提高路堤的临界回填高度,在满足路面工后沉降控制指标的基础上.可以取代软基处治,缩短工期,降低工程造价。运用型有限元软件.计算和分析轻质固化粉煤灰作为路堤回填材料的土压力及其表面的沉降变形,并进行轻质固化粉煤灰路基回填的沉降分析和试验段观测,可为固化粉煤灰在软土地基路堤回填工程中的应用提供理论依据。

关 键 词:道路工程  固化粉煤灰  路堤回填材料  沉降分析

Settlement Analysis of Softground Embankment with Fly-ash Solidified Filler

Abstract:Fly-ash solidified filler can enhance critical filling height of embankment. On the basis of settlement control indices of pavement, it can substitute for softground treatment, decrease construc- tion time, and reduce construction cost. With ABAQUS software, soil pressure and settlement deforma- tion of fly-ash solidified filler are calculated and analyzed. Results of settlement analysis and survey of trial road can provide theoretical basis for its application in softground filling projects.
Keywords:highway engineering  fly-ash solidified filler  embankment backfill material  settlement analysis
